Applicant Privacy Notice
This notice explains how Liso.xyz (“Liso”, “we”, “us”) collects, uses, and protects information you submit when you apply for a role with us. This notice supplements our general Privacy Policy and applies specifically to job applicants.
Information We Collect
When you apply for a role, we collect the information you provide directly, including your name, email address, phone number, location, resume/CV, links you choose to share (such as LinkedIn or a portfolio), your answers to application questions, and your eligibility/work authorization response.
Why We Collect It
We use this information solely to evaluate your candidacy for the role(s) you apply to, to communicate with you about your application, and to maintain records required for lawful recruiting practices.
Resume and Document Handling
Resumes are validated for file type and safety before being stored in a private, access-controlled location. Resumes are not publicly accessible and are only viewable by authorized recruiting personnel.
Technology-Assisted Review
Liso may use software tools to help organize and evaluate applications against the specific requirements of a role. Any such tool is a decision-support aid only. Final hiring decisions, including any decision not to move forward with a candidate, are made by a human member of our team, not by software alone. Protected characteristics (such as race, sex, religion, national origin, disability, age, or similar attributes) are not used as scoring criteria.
Service Providers
We may use trusted service providers (such as our website host, email delivery provider, and, if and when approved, a resume-scanning or AI evaluation provider) to help operate the recruiting process. We do not sell applicant information. We do not use your resume or application answers to train general-purpose AI models.
Retention
We retain application records for a limited period tied to legitimate recruiting and legal recordkeeping needs. Retention periods are subject to internal review and are not indefinite.
